AM systems work by adding material layer by layer to create a three-dimensional object, unlike traditional manufacturing processes that involve subtracting material from a larger piece This unique approach offers a number of advantages, such as increased design freedom, reduced waste, faster production times, and cost savings.
One of the key benefits of AM systems is the ability to create complex and intricate designs that would be nearly impossible to achieve using traditional manufacturing methods This level of design freedom allows businesses to experiment with new concepts and ideas, leading to innovative products that can set them apart from their competitors Additionally, AM systems can produce parts with internal geometries that are not feasible with traditional methods, opening up new possibilities for customized and specialized products.
Another major advantage of AM systems is the reduction of material waste during the manufacturing process Traditional manufacturing methods often involve cutting, milling, or drilling away excess material, resulting in a significant amount of waste In contrast, AM systems only use the material that is necessary to create the final product, minimizing waste and reducing environmental impact This not only benefits the planet but also helps businesses save money on material costs.
Furthermore, AM systems offer faster production times compared to traditional manufacturing methods Since additive manufacturing does not require the production of molds or tooling, products can be designed and produced in a fraction of the time it would take using traditional processes This rapid prototyping capability allows businesses to quickly test and iterate on new product ideas, bringing them to market faster and staying ahead of the competition.

While the initial investment in AM equipment may be higher than traditional manufacturing machinery, businesses can save money in the long run by reducing material waste, streamlining production processes, and increasing efficiency Additionally, businesses can save on storage and inventory costs by using AM systems to produce parts on-demand, eliminating the need for large stockpiles of inventory.
AM systems are being used across a wide range of industries, including aerospace, automotive, healthcare, and consumer goods In the aerospace industry, AM systems are being used to produce lightweight and complex components for aircraft that improve fuel efficiency and reduce emissions In the automotive industry, AM systems are being used to prototype new vehicle designs and produce customized parts for high-performance vehicles In the healthcare industry, AM systems are being used to create patient-specific medical implants and prosthetics that improve outcomes for patients.
